St. Andrews University vs. Cleveland Institute of Music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, St. Andrews University or Cleveland Institute of Music?

  • Cleveland Institute of Music is 36.1% more expensive to attend than St. Andrews University for in-state tuition ($40,000.00 vs. $29,400.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 36.1% higher at Cleveland Institute of Music than St. Andrews University ($40,000.00 vs. $29,400.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at St. Andrews University than Cleveland Institute of Music ($31,503 vs. $36,001)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at St. Andrews University are 19.5% lower than costs at Cleveland Institute of Music ($12,180 vs. $14,550)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Cleveland Institute of Music than St. Andrews University (100% vs. 98%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Cleveland Institute of Music students is 25.5% larger than aid received St. Andrews University ($22,842 vs. $18,206)

St. Andrews University vs. Cleveland Institute of Music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, St. Andrews University or Cleveland Institute of Music?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Cleveland Institute of Music and St. Andrews University.

  • The graduation rate at Cleveland Institute of Music is higher than St. Andrews University (67% vs. 43%)
  • Graduates from Cleveland Institute of Music earn on average $8,800 more per year than St. Andrews University graduates after ten years. ($45,200 vs. $36,400)
  • St. Andrews University students graduate with a $4,500 lower median federal student loan debt than Cleveland Institute of Music graduates. ($22,500 vs. $27,000)
  • St. Andrews University graduates are paying $47 less per month on federal student loans than Cleveland Institute of Music graduates. ($232 vs. $279)
  • More Cleveland Institute of Music gra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former St. Andrews University students, three years after graduation. (68% vs. 41%)
